Revopoint MetroX Advanced: Blue Laser Line and Full-field Structured Light 3D Scanner.
Cross Lines – Up to 800,00 points per second with GPU-accelerated* 14 crossed blue laser lines.
*GPU Compatibility: Only NVIDIA RTX 30 and 40 Series GPUs are currently supported – Windows Only
Parallel Lines – Capture objects with 7 high-powered parallel blue laser lines.
Full-field Blue Structured Light – Get it scanned fast at up to 7 million points per second using 62 lines of structured blue light.
Auto Turntable – One-click scans with the Dual-axis Turntable, Revo Scan, and MetroX working in unison.

Reverse Engineering – Whatever your workpiece, MetroX streamlines your reverse engineering processes with metrology-grade 3D models ready for scan-to-CAD processes.
Quality Control – With MetroX’s high-quality 3D models, defects and deviations in the manufacturing process can be rapidly identified to ensure that even complex parts or products meet the design tolerance requirements.
Additive Manufacturing – Use MetroX to create an ultra-accurate digital twin of nearly any small to medium object for consistent 3D-printed reproductions.
Rapid Prototyping – Accelerate rapid prototyping by using MetroX to capture accurate dimensions of objects, ensuring the prototype meets design requirements, minimises iterations, and saves time and resources.
Compatible Operating Systems: Windows 10/11 (64-bit), macOS 11.0 or better |
Scanning Type: Handheld and Desktop |
Built-in Chip Computing: Depth Map Computing |
Technology: Multi-line Laser Scan and Full-field Structured Light Scan |
Buttons: 4 |
Scannable Object Size: Small to Medium |
Outdoor Scanning: No |
Single-frame Precision: Up to 0.01 mm |
Output File Formats: PLY, OBJ, STL, ASC, 3MF, GLTF, FBX |
Single-frame Accuracy: Up to 0.03 mm |
Ready to Print 3D Models: |
Yes |
Volumetric Accuracy: |
0.03 mm + 0.1 mm × L (m) |
L is the length of the object |
Fused Point Distance: Up to 0.05 mm |
Working Distance: 200 ~ 400 mm |
Connector Type: USB Type-C |
Single Capture Area at Nearest Distance: 160 x 70 mm at 200 mm |
Power Requirements: DC 12v, 3a |
Single Capture Area at Furthest Distance: 320 x 215 mm at 400 mm |
3D Light Source: 14 Blue Cross Laser Lines / 7 Blue Parallel Laser Lines / 62 Line Blue Full-field Structured Light |
Angular Field of View (H x V): 43 × 33° |
Dimensions (L x W x H): 209 × 88 × 44 mm |
Maximum Scan Volume: 1 × 1 × 1 m |
Minimum Scan Volume: 10 × 10 × 10 mm |
User Recalibration: Yes |
Scanning Speed: Up to Multi-line Blue Laser: 800,000 Points/s – Full Field Blue Light: 7,000,000 Points/s |
Special Object Scanning |
Please use scanning spray when scanning transparent or specular surfaces in Multi-Line Laser modes. |
Using scanning spray is recommended when scanning transparent, black, specular, or highly reflective surfaces in Full-Field Structured Light modes. |
Depth Camera Resolution: Up to 2 Megapixels |
RGB Camera Resolution: 2 Megapixels |
Supported Accessories: Dual-axis Turntable, Marker Block Kit |
Colour Scanning: Only in Auto Turntable Mode |
CPU: 4-core ARM, 2.0 GHz |
Tracking Methods: Feature, Marker, Global Marker |
Fill Lights: 12 Blue LEDS |

NOTES: |
1. Precision is how close repeated measurements of the same object at a single angle are to each other. Accuracy is how close a measured value at a single angle is to the actual (true) value. They were both acquired in a controlled lab environment. Actual results might vary, subject to the operating environment. |
2. Class 2M Laser Safety Tips: |
(1) The product uses a Class 2M laser projector. Avoid looking directly at it at close range! Please refer to the Class 2M laser standard document for details. |
(2) To avoid retina damage, don’t look directly into the laser beam through optical instruments capable of magnifying it (e.g., telescopes and camera lenses). |
(3) To prevent laser reflection, avoid placing reflective surfaces like mirrors or glass in the path of the laser beam. |
3. This product has flashing lights, which may not be suitable for people with photosensitive epilepsy. |
